Output 98852675b3d84abb2077b837990083991d860c72fa78e9a19195902cb69d9fc7:0

value
17791
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b005c0122a43f359bc126ff1b8dacc2921084897 OP_EQUALVERIFY OP_CHECKSIG
address
1H3ipJJsdx4hvZbrywbociQSmUNeERCaKJ
transaction
98852675b3d84abb2077b837990083991d860c72fa78e9a19195902cb69d9fc7
spent
true